You Will:

  • Manage the full lifecycle of leave of absence, disability, accommodation, and workers’ compensation cases for assigned regions.
  • Serve as a subject matter expert to employees and managers on leave policies and processes.
  • Ensure timely case updates and thorough documentation in the leave management system.
  • Communicate status updates and next steps clearly and professionally to employees and managers.
  • Interpret and apply relevant laws including FMLA, ADA, CFRA, PDL, and state-specific leave regulations.
  • Collaborate with HR Business Partners and department leaders to ensure a smooth transition and proper coverage during employee leaves.
  • Partner with third-party vendors and internal stakeholders to monitor and track claims, ensuring appropriate return-to-work plans are developed.
  • Meet or exceed key performance indicators including case turnaround times, response rates, and documentation compliance.
  • Escalate complex cases to the Manager, Leave Management, Director, Shared Services, VP, Human Resources, or Legal as appropriate.

To Ensure Success in This Role, You Must Have:

  • High school diploma or equivalent required; associate or b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business, or related field preferred.
  • Minimum of 2 years of experience managing leave of absence and accommodation cases in a high-volume, multi-state environment.
  • Working knowledge of federal and state leave regulations including FMLA, CFRA, PDL, ADA, NYPFL, NJPFLI, and workers’ compensation.
  • Experience using a leave management system and HRIS platforms preferred.
  • Strong organizational, documentation, and time-management skills.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to handle confidential information with discretion and professionalism.
